1.1 Children and families :

Born on April 7, 1989 in Les Abymes, Guadeloupe, Teddy Riner showed signs of greatness from an early age – how many children can throw their stuffed animals to the ground with such ease? Raised in a sports-loving family, Riner’s parents, Moïse and Annick, recognized his natural talent and supported him every step of the way, unknowingly paving the way for their son to become a judo legend.

3.1 Olympic triumphs :

When it comes to Olympic success, Teddy Riner is no stranger to the podium – it’s practically his second home. He won his first Olympic gold medal at the 2008 Beijing Games, and hasn’t stopped there. Riner went on to win two more consecutive Olympic gold medals in 2012 and 2016, cementing his status as an irresistible force in the world of judo.

3.2 World Championship titles :

To say that Teddy Riner owns the World Championships is an understatement. He amassed a staggering ten (!) world titles, dominating the heavyweight category like a boss. 4.1 Unique physical attributes :

What sets Teddy Riner apart is his imposing physical presence. Measuring 2.04 metres, he casts a larger-than-life shadow over his opponents. His long limbs and Herculean strength give him a distinct advantage, enabling him to execute throws and maneuvers that seem impossible for mere mortals.
